Ruling comes amid demolition threats by Donald Trump after being stymied from adding his name to centre A federal judge has ordered the Trump administration to give at least 30 days’ notice before moving to demolish the John F Kennedy Center for the Performing Arts after the US president warned that it could be “ripped down”. The US district judge Christopher Cooper issued the order on Thursday after lawyers for the Democratic congresswoman Joyce Beatty submitted evidence of Trump’s comments and sought clarification over whether the building could be closed or bulldozed. Investigation deems poor accommodation contributed to deaths of children – 42 less than a year old
Temporary accommodation has contributed to the deaths of dozens of babies in England, according to investigations into child deaths over a four-year period.
In figures that MPs and the government called “shocking”, living in temporary accommodation was a factor in the unexpected deaths of 55 children between 1 April 2019 and 31 March 2023, according to official reviewers. It found that 42 of those who died were less than a year old.
